Chocolate babka is a delicious bread with chocolate swirls and a fluffy texture similar to coffee cake. Sometimes it’s topped with crumbs of halva, a sesame-based sweet. Chocolate Babka Ice Cream Cookie Sandwich

  • Prep Time:15 minutes
  • Cook Time:1 hour 15 minutes
  • Total Time:1 hour 30 minutes
  • Servings:6
  • Advanced

    Ingredients

  • 3 sticks of unsalted butter, room temperature
  • 3/4 cup granulated sugar
  • 1 1/2 cup brown sugar
  • 1 semisweet chocolate bar, chopped
  • 2 eggs
  • 2 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 3 1/4 all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• 2 teaspoon cinnamon
  • Pinch of salt
  • 1 challah bread, cut into 1/2 inch cubes
  • 3/4 cup powdered sugar
  • 1 pint vanilla ice cream
  • 1 spoonful of tahini
  • Sesame seeds for rolling

  • Step 1

    Preheat your oven to 350°F.

  • Step 2

    In a bowl, combine the dry ingredients: 2 1/2 cups of flour, baking soda, cinnamon, and salt. Set aside.

  • Step 3

    In a separate bowl, beat 2 sticks of butter with granulated and brown sugar until it is fluffy.

  • Step 4

    Add both eggs one at a time. Then add vanilla extract.

  • Step 5

    Add the dry ingredients to the wet ingredients in 3 parts until combined.

  • Step 6

    Roughly chop the chocolate bar into small chunks. Then cut the challah bread into 1/2 inch cubes.

  • Step 7

    Add challah cubes and chocolate pieces to the dough and mix until incorporated.

  • Step 8

    Dollop the cookie dough onto a parchment covered baking sheet and bake for 10 minutes.

  • Step 9

    While the cookies bake, make the crumble by combining 1 stick of butter, 3/4 cups all-purpose flour, and 3/4 cups of powdered sugar.

  • Step 10

    After 10 minutes, take the cookies out of oven and add crumble topping. Bake again for 3-5 minutes.

  • Step 11

    Cool the cookies on a baking sheet for 30 minutes to 1 hour until room temperature.

  • Step 12

    For the tahini ice cream, soften the ice cream and add in a spoonful of tahini. Mix until well combined and then place in the freezer to harden.

  • Step 13

    Once your cookies are cool and ice cream has re-hardened, you are ready to assemble your ice cream sandwich. Scoop the ice cream in between two cookies, roll the edges in sesame seeds and enjoy.
